"You know Top Round as "that place on Wilshire you always drive by." From the outside, it's a kitschy '50s-style roast beef stand that looks as if it's been untouched since Truman was president. But on the inside, it's, well... exactly that. We love how unabashedly average their roast beef sandwiches are (even smothered in cheese), and the way their frozen custard always seems to hit the spot. You order at the window, then find a seat at one of the large red tables where the paint's peeling off." - Kat Hong
"Where else in LA can one get curly fries, roast beef, and breakfast sandwiches all under the same orange roof? It’s all about convenience and comfort at Top Round, the tiny walk-up spot on the corner of La Brea and Olympic." - Eater Staff
"Top Round is a roast beef stand that seems pulled from time. The orange-hued corner spot does curly fries, simple roast beef and horseradish sandwiches, and more, all while keeping a its throwback vibe and easy, sunny appeal." - Farley Elliott
